Building with a Comprehensive Parts Library
Users begin their project in Evertech Sandbox by accessing a detailed menu filled with structural components, wheels, engines, pistons, weapons, and logic gates. The core interaction involves selecting these parts and connecting them together on a blank grid or a pre-built chassis. Players drag, rotate, and snap pieces into place, carefully considering how each joint and connection will behave under the simulated physical forces. This initial building phase is the foundation for all subsequent testing and iteration in Evertech Sandbox, setting the stage for success or a spectacular failure.
Testing Creations in a Dynamic Physics Environment
After assembling a machine, the next critical step is to enter the test drive mode. Here, users activate their creation’s engines, weapons, or other systems to observe its real-time performance. The sophisticated physics engine in Evertech Sandbox calculates stresses, collisions, and momentum, providing immediate and often unpredictable feedback. Players must analyze why a vehicle flips over, a crane arm breaks, or a rocket fails to launch. This trial-and-error process is essential for diagnosing design flaws and understanding mechanical principles, which is a central appeal of the Evertech Sandbox experience.

Experimenting with Logic and Weapon Systems
Beyond basic vehicles, Evertech Sandbox offers advanced components like programmable logic blocks and an arsenal of weaponry. Players can wire logic gates to create automated sequences, such as having a piston fire only when a sensor is triggered. They can also arm their creations with machine guns, cannons, and explosives to build combat vehicles. Users test these systems in combat scenarios or obstacle courses, adding a layer of strategic depth and destructive fun to the sandbox. This feature expands the creative potential of Evertech Sandbox immensely.
Sharing and Exploring Community Creations
A significant aspect of the Evertech Sandbox ecosystem is its community workshop. After perfecting a build, players can upload their creation for others to download, rate, and test. Conversely, users can browse a vast online gallery to import thousands of player-made machines, from hypercars and helicopters to walking mechs. This allows players to deconstruct complex designs made by others, learn new building techniques, and find inspiration for their next project. This sharing mechanic ensures the content within Evertech Sandbox is constantly evolving.
